Designing for Pacific Northwest Weather

The wet coastal environment demands thoughtful outdoor planning. A skilled landscape architect plans with constant moisture, seasonal flooding, and year-round growth cycles in mind. This informed approach reduces mold, rot, and plant failure while maintaining beauty across all seasons.

Using Indigenous Flora

Featuring native plants Washington not only enhances biodiversity but also reduces maintenance needs. These adapted species survive local pests, soils, and rainfall with minimal irrigation or chemical help. A experienced landscape designer in Issaquah pairs them for visual impact.

  • Plant salal, red flowering currant, and Oregon grape for continuous appeal
  • Remove invasives like English ivy or laurel in favor of native alternatives

Qualifications to Look For

Not all designers are equal—know the difference between a licensed landscape architect and a general landscape designer. Only a regulated professional can approve plans for large structural projects, retaining walls over 4 feet, or work near wetlands. For complex builds requiring permits, always confirm their credentials with the Washington State Landscape Architect Board.

Typical Landscape Design Costs in Issaquah

Consulting a certified professional in the Pacific Northwest typically costs from $2,000 to $8,000. Rates vary based on design scale, level of customization, and whether erosion control is required. Affordable landscape design is possible with phased development and smart material choices.

  • Basic design review: from $1,500
  • Mid-Range outdoor living design: $3,500–$6,500
  • Commercial Landscape Planning: $7,000+
  • Design-Build solutions: often calculated with materials

Low-Water Landscaping for Sustainable Yards

Creating with dry-adapted plants helps conserve resources and cut watering needs. In the Pacific Northwest climate, local species like kinnikinnick, red flowering currant, and camas thrive with reduced summer watering. A Issaquah-based designer can pair these with permeable hardscapes for a lush, self-sustaining yard.
